At Databricks, Lakebase and Databricks Apps enable teams to build data-native applications where transactional data, analytics, and AI operate on the same platform. Lakebase provides a managed Postgres transactional layer for application state and operational workloads, while Databricks Apps supports building and deploying secure applications that run close to governed data and models.

About Databricks
Databricks is the data and AI company. More than 10,000 organizations worldwide — including Comcast, Condé Nast, Grammarly, and over 50% of the Fortune 500 — rely on the Databricks Data Intelligence Platform to unify and democratize data, analytics and AI. Databricks is headquartered in San Francisco, with offices around the globe and was founded by the original creators of Lakehouse, Apache Spark™, Delta Lake and MLflow.
